/**
* \brief Read the bytes of a hash from an hexadecimal string
*
* \param hash buffer to store the resulting bytes
* \param string hexadecimal string representing the hash
* \param filename file name from where the string was read
* \param line_no file line number from where the string was read
* \param expected_len the expected length of the string that was read
*
* \retval -1 the hexadecimal string is invalid
* \retval 1 the hexadecimal string was read successfully
*/
int ReadHashString(uint8_t *hash, const char *string, const char *filename, int line_no,
uint16_t expected_len)
{
if (strlen(string) != expected_len) {
SCLogError(SC_ERR_INVALID_HASH, "%s:%d hash string not %d characters",
filename, line_no, expected_len);
return -1;
}
int i, x;
for (x = 0, i = 0; i < expected_len; i+=2, x++) {
char buf[3] = { 0, 0, 0 };
buf[0] = string[i];
buf[1] = string[i+1];
long value = strtol(buf, NULL, 16);
if (value >= 0 && value <= 255)
hash[x] = (uint8_t)value;
else {
SCLogError(SC_ERR_INVALID_HASH, "%s:%d hash byte out of range %ld",
filename, line_no, value);
return -1;
}
}
return 1;
}
/**
* \brief Store a hash into the hash table
*
* \param hash_table hash table that will hold the hash
* \param string hexadecimal string representing the hash
* \param filename file name from where the string was read
* \param line_no file line number from where the string was read
* \param type the hash algorithm
*
* \retval -1 failed to load the hash into the hash table
* \retval 1 successfully loaded the has into the hash table
*/
int LoadHashTable(ROHashTable *hash_table, const char *string, const char *filename,
int line_no, uint32_t type)
{
/* allocate the maximum size a hash can have (in this case is SHA256, 32 bytes) */
uint8_t hash[32];
/* specify the actual size that should be read depending on the hash algorithm */
uint16_t size = 32;
if (type == DETECT_FILEMD5) {
size = 16;
}
else if (type == DETECT_FILESHA1) {
size = 20;
}
/* every byte represented with hexadecimal digits is two characters */
uint16_t expected_len = (size * 2);
if (ReadHashString(hash, string, filename, line_no, expected_len) == 1) {
if (ROHashInitQueueValue(hash_table, &hash, size) != 1)
return -1;
}
return 1;
}
/**
* \brief Match a hash stored in a hash table
*
* \param hash_table hash table that will hold the hash
* \param hash buffer containing the bytes of the has
* \param hash_len length of the hash buffer
*
* \retval 0 didn't find the specified hash
* \retval 1 the hash matched a stored value
*/
static int HashMatchHashTable(ROHashTable *hash_table, uint8_t *hash,
size_t hash_len)
{
void *ptr = ROHashLookup(hash_table, hash, (uint16_t)hash_len);
if (ptr == NULL)
return 0;
else
return 1;
}
/**
* \brief Match the specified file hash
*
* \param det_ctx pattern matcher thread local data
* \param f *LOCKED* flow
* \param flags direction flags
* \param file file being inspected
* \param s signature being inspected
* \param m sigmatch that we will cast into DetectFileHashData
*
* \retval 0 no match
* \retval 1 match
*/
int DetectFileHashMatch (DetectEngineThreadCtx *det_ctx,
Flow *f, uint8_t flags, File *file, const Signature *s, const SigMatchCtx *m)
{
SCEnter();
int ret = 0;
DetectFileHashData *filehash = (DetectFileHashData *)m;
if (file->state != FILE_STATE_CLOSED) {
SCReturnInt(0);
}
int match = -1;
if (s->file_flags & FILE_SIG_NEED_MD5 && file->flags & FILE_MD5) {
match = HashMatchHashTable(filehash->hash, file->md5, sizeof(file->md5));
}
else if (s->file_flags & FILE_SIG_NEED_SHA1 && file->flags & FILE_SHA1) {
match = HashMatchHashTable(filehash->hash, file->sha1, sizeof(file->sha1));
}
else if (s->file_flags & FILE_SIG_NEED_SHA256 && file->flags & FILE_SHA256) {
match = HashMatchHashTable(filehash->hash, file->sha256, sizeof(file->sha256));
}
if (match == 1) {
if (filehash->negated == 0)
ret = 1;
else
ret = 0;
}
else if (match == 0) {
if (filehash->negated == 0)
ret = 0;
else
ret = 1;
}
SCReturnInt(ret);
}
static const char *hexcodes = "ABCDEFabcdef0123456789";
/**
* \brief Parse the filemd5, filesha1 or filesha256 keyword
*
* \param det_ctx pattern matcher thread local data
* \param str Pointer to the user provided option
* \param type the hash algorithm
*
* \retval hash pointer to DetectFileHashData on success
* \retval NULL on failure
*/
static DetectFileHashData *DetectFileHashParse (const DetectEngineCtx *de_ctx,
const char *str, uint32_t type)
{
DetectFileHashData *filehash = NULL;
FILE *fp = NULL;
char *filename = NULL;
char *rule_filename = NULL;
/* We have a correct hash algorithm option */
filehash = SCMalloc(sizeof(DetectFileHashData));
if (unlikely(filehash == NULL))
goto error;
memset(filehash, 0x00, sizeof(DetectFileHashData));
if (strlen(str) && str[0] == '!') {
filehash->negated = 1;
str++;
}
if (type == DETECT_FILEMD5) {
filehash->hash = ROHashInit(18, 16);
}
else if (type == DETECT_FILESHA1) {
filehash->hash = ROHashInit(18, 20);
}
else if (type == DETECT_FILESHA256) {
filehash->hash = ROHashInit(18, 32);
}
if (filehash->hash == NULL) {
goto error;
}
/* get full filename */
filename = DetectLoadCompleteSigPath(de_ctx, str);
if (filename == NULL) {
goto error;
}
rule_filename = SCStrdup(de_ctx->rule_file);
if (rule_filename == NULL) {
goto error;
}
char line[8192] = "";
fp = fopen(filename, "r");
if (fp == NULL) {
#ifdef HAVE_LIBGEN_H
if (de_ctx->rule_file != NULL) {
char *dir = dirname(rule_filename);
if (dir != NULL) {
char path[PATH_MAX];
snprintf(path, sizeof(path), "%s/%s", dir, str);
fp = fopen(path, "r");
if (fp == NULL) {
SCLogError(SC_ERR_OPENING_RULE_FILE,
"opening hash file %s: %s", path, strerror(errno));
goto error;
}
}
}
if (fp == NULL) {
#endif
SCLogError(SC_ERR_OPENING_RULE_FILE, "opening hash file %s: %s", filename, strerror(errno));
goto error;
#ifdef HAVE_LIBGEN_H
}
#endif
}
int line_no = 0;
while(fgets(line, (int)sizeof(line), fp) != NULL) {
size_t valid = 0, len = strlen(line);
line_no++;
while (strchr(hexcodes, line[valid]) != NULL && valid++ < len);
/* lines that do not contain sequentially any valid character are ignored */
if (valid == 0)
continue;
/* ignore anything after the sequence of valid characters */
line[valid] = '\0';
if (LoadHashTable(filehash->hash, line, filename, line_no, type) != 1) {
goto error;
}
}
fclose(fp);
fp = NULL;
if (ROHashInitFinalize(filehash->hash) != 1) {
goto error;
}
SCLogInfo("Hash hash table size %u bytes%s", ROHashMemorySize(filehash->hash), filehash->negated ? ", negated match" : "");
SCFree(rule_filename);
SCFree(filename);
return filehash;
error:
if (filehash != NULL)
DetectFileHashFree((DetectEngineCtx *) de_ctx, filehash);
if (fp != NULL)
fclose(fp);
if (filename != NULL)
SCFree(filename);
if (rule_filename != NULL) {
SCFree(rule_filename);
}
return NULL;
}
